Hamlet Storm Sewage Water Drivers
Water damage in Hamlet tends to cluster in predictable windows because of the local climate. Hamlet, North Carolina, experiences seasonal flooding due to its proximity to the Pee Dee River, which increases the risk of sewage backups during heavy rainfall. The town's older infrastructure also contributes to frequent pipe failures, particularly in areas with clay soil that can cause root intrusion.
Hamlet's humid subtropical climate leads to high moisture levels, which can accelerate the growth of mold and bacteria in sewage-damaged areas. This climate also increases the likelihood of prolonged water exposure, compounding cleanup challenges.
